Hmm, it’s been awhile since I heard an actual punk release. I thought punk rock was wiped out by an asteroid or something.
The Virgins at first sounded sloppy and abrasive, but they quickly won me over with catchy choruses, a leaning toward street punk over punkcore, and some flashy guitar solos. The vocals have a colicky, crusty edge, but are tempered by midtempo melody lines and background chantalongs.
The drumming needs to be reigned in and work a bit tighter with the band. I’d also recommend a lozenge for the singer. But then again – and I have to keep reminding myself since it’s been so long – this is punk rock.
